Resetting a tire pressure monitor system is likely required if any of the following procedures are performed on a vehicle:
Tire pressure correction(s)
Tire / wheel rotation
Tire / wheel replacement
Wheel electronic unit replacement
Receiving antenna replacement
Control unit replacement
Loss of sensor or vehicle battery power
The Tire Pressure Monitor contains a simple-to-use interface. Once the vehicle's Make-Model- Year is entered, the user is provided with the ability to reset or diagnose the TPMS.
If a RESET PROCEDURE is selected, the monitor directs the user to the correct section of the manual for the vehicle entered. In most cases, the tool is used in conjunction with the reset procedure.
If DIAGNOSTICS is selected, data for troubleshooting the TPMS can be obtained by using the monitor to activate the sensors and inspect the transmitted data in most cases.
Displays sensor data, such as ID and pressure. Sensor activation and data display are dependent upon system type.
